Transaction 431373823a40312b735f40a37428d0670e07cfa6bf6de8fa6b7125d0e4a25b07
1 Input
1 Output
-
431373823a40312b735f40a37428d0670e07cfa6bf6de8fa6b7125d0e4a25b07:0
- value
- 2298791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8f6be774d8fb08cec669c901fce3e38c61b214b OP_EQUAL
- address
- 3MUDU43iySiV3WvmV43w5aKNEYQyizkid5